USCCB: October prayer initiatives for respect for life, religious liberty
CWN - October 01, 2012
The United States Conference of Catholic Bishops has issued a Holy Hour for Life and Religious Liberty for use during the month of October to complement its recently announced special Mass and Rosary novena.
“This past spring, the bishops urged an intensification of prayer efforts for religious freedom in our country,” according to the web page devoted to the initiatives. “With October being Respect Life Month and the Month of the Holy Rosary, it seems an appropriate time to ask for Our Lady's intercession for these intentions.”
The holy hour includes the singing of the O Salutaris Hostia and Tantum Ergo Sacramentum, Scripture readings, Benediction, and prayers, including a prayer “for all churches, agencies, employers, healthcare providers and individuals: that they may be free from government mandates that would compel them to compromise their beliefs.”
